Mostly known by his map illustrations, including one of Petworth, Adam Dant’s artworks chronicle life in their densely wrought depictions of public spaces, where historical motifs mingle with present-day observations to create wryly humorous views of contemporary culture. Dant’s combination of master draftsmanship and a wonderfully imaginative vision has led to him being hailed as a ‘modern day Hogarth’. Dant was the recipient of The Rome Scholarship in printmaking in 1993, The Jerwood Drawing Prize in 2002 and was appointed by parliament as ‘The Official Artist of The 2015 UK General Election’.
Adam Dant’s work is exhibited internationally and is in the collections of Tate Britain, MOMA, New York, Deutsche Bank, UBS, Musee D’Art Contemporain, Lyon, HRH The Prince of Wales The Museum of London and various other public and private collections.
